There's minimal cushioning—let's be real, it’s not a React or Zoom kind of ride. But for casual wear? It's totally fine. The fit is true to size for me, with a snug (but not tight) wrap around the midfoot. The "air jordan 1 low black and white" is lightweight and easy to wear all day. Now, who should maybe skip it? If you're all about that cutting-edge tech and bounce in your step, you might be disappointed. This isn't a performance shoe – it's a lifestyle icon. Also, if you already own multiple black/white lows, this is just another one. But for most? At this $120 price point in the Jordan series, it's a solid pick-up. Who is this shoe for? Honestly, it's a gateway sneaker. If you're new to the Jordan series or just want a reliable, stylish low-top, the Air Jordan 1 Low Black and White is a no-brainer. It's also perfect for minimalists who love a monochrome palette. Not for who? Performance basketball players—obviously—or folks seeking max comfort tech. It's a style icon, not a tech marvel. Let's talk about the style, because that's the real win. Wearing this Air Jordan 1 Low out, it just goes with everything — jeans, shorts, sweats. The black and white contrast pops without being loud. On camera, it's a dream for fit pics. Compared to some bulkier sneakers, this low-top keeps things sleek. The design is so simple, so effective. It's a wardrobe staple, for real.
